What is Plogging?
Plogging refers to the act of picking up trash while running. The expression stems from the combination of the Swedish term "plocka upp" meaning "to pick up" and the English term “jogging”. This activity will introduce new movements into your run while helping clean up our planet.

About Tina Muir:
As a mother of two and an elite marathoner, Tina aims to inspire change through running. She is the founder and CEO of Running for Real, a podcast that encourages runners to be brave and leave their comfort zones to address the climate emergency. She believes in running as a vehicle for social change.
She is also the author of “Becoming a Sustainable Runner”, a practical guide for runners of all abilities and backgrounds who want to take meaningful action to protect our planet through their love of the sport.
